老师,这是在一个Class里面建的吗?为啥我的Dog有错误

来源:2-8 自由编程

阿硕A

2020-01-14 18:07:41

package com.imooc.runnable;


class Cat implements Runnable{

	@Override
	public void run() {
		// TODO Auto-generated method stub
		for(int i=1;i<=4;i++) {
			System.out.println(Thread.currentThread().getName()+"A cat");
		}
	}
class Dog implements Runnable{

	@Override
	public void run() {
		// TODO Auto-generated method stub
		for(int i=1;i<=3;i++) {
			System.out.println(Thread.currentThread().getName()+"A dog");
		}
	}
	
}
	
}
public class RunnableText {

	public static void main(String[] args) {
		// TODO Auto-generated method stub

		Cat cat=new Cat();
		Thread thread1=new Thread(cat);
		thread1.start();
		Dog dog=new Dog();
		Thread thread2=new Thread(dog);
		thread2.start();
		for(int i=1;i<=3;i++) {
			System.out.println("main thread");
		}
	}

}


写回答

1回答

好帮手慕小脸

2020-01-14

同学你好,

    1、是在一个class里面建的。

    2、老师测试了同学的代码,是可以正常运行的,同学所说的“Dog有错误”具体错哪。老师未能找到,还请同学可以将错误信息或截图贴出,方便老师解决问题。

如果我的回答解决了你的疑惑,请采纳,祝学习愉快~

0

0 学习 · 11489 问题

查看课程